WebContinuous oral dosing regimens used in the literature vary; European epidemiologic data suggest the lowest rates of late VKDB with oral vitamin K 1 mg at birth followed by 25 μg daily for 13 weeks, or 2 mg at birth followed by 1 mg weekly for 3 months. WebAdministering PO vitamin K (2.0 mg at birth, repeated at 2 to 4 and 6 to 8 weeks of age), should be confined to newborns whose parents decline IM vitamin K. WebPreterm infants weighing ≤1500 g should receive a vitamin K dose of 0.3 mg/kg to 0.5 mg/kg as a single, intramuscular dose. Pediatricians and other health care providers must be aware of the benefits of vitamin K administration as well as the risks of refusal and convey this information to the infant’s caregivers. WebFeb 19, 2024 · intramuscular (IM) dose of vitamin K to prevent vitamin K deficiency bleeding (VKDB). Is oral vitamin K an acceptable substitute for the injection? No. Oral vitamin K for newborns does not meet the requirements of NYS regulation and is not recommended by the New York State Department of Health or the American Academy of Pediatrics.¹
